Subject: Rate limiting in the Corvex gateway — what you need to know

Hi Darla,

Welcome to the rotation. The Corvex gateway enforces per-service token buckets: defaults are 500 req/s, with overrides in the limits manifest. When a service trips its bucket, callers see 429s with a retry-after header — do not raise limits mid-incident without checking downstream capacity first. Shed load via the priority lanes instead. The override procedure and manifest location are documented on the page below.

runbook for badug-kadup: https://confluence.zemvarlabs.internal/projects/browse/display/projects/bd1b

INTERNAL MEMO — Transition to Annual Billing

To: Heads of Department
From: T. Marroway, Commercial Operations

Effective next quarter, Penlow Suite customers will be moved from monthly to annual billing cycles. Renewal notices will be issued sixty days ahead, and finance will reconcile prorated balances carefully to avoid double-charging. Department heads should brief their teams before any customer communication. The underlying rationale is summarised in the note below.

board note of bawep-tajef: Queniusek Systems plans to raise the Quenvan list price by 53.1 percent in March. The pricing group signed off on a budget of $176.4 million for Project Drueth. The renewal with Casionix Partners closes at $142.5 million a year, 8.3 percent below the last contract. Project Fraax slips by six weeks because of the tooling delay.

Finance Review Summary — Licensing Dispute. Torvane Analytics disputes royalty calculations under our agreement for the Clearpath engine. Claimed shortfall: mid six figures over eight quarters. Our counsel at Bramley & Hode views exposure as overstated; settlement range modeled conservatively. Accrual booked this quarter; no restatement needed. Negotiations resume next month. Avoid public comment until resolution. Strategic implications for the incoming director are summarized in the confidential line below:

internal memo for faweg-tafog: Only 7 of the 100 pilot accounts renewed Quenael, so a churn review is set for April 15.